Step-by-step explanation:
Using SOH CAH TOA in trigonometry identity to find the sin Y, cos Y and Tan Y
Note that the hypotenuse is the longest side = 25
The opposite will be the side facing the acute angle Y
Opposite = 7
Adjacent = 24
For Sin Y
[tex]\sin =\frac{Opposite}{Hypotenuse}[/tex]
Sin Y = 7/25
For cos Y:
[tex]\cos Y = \frac{Adjacent}{Hypotenuse}[/tex]
Cos Y = 24/25
For tan Y:
[tex]\tan Y = \frac{Opposite}{Adjacent }[/tex]
Tan Y = 7/24
